Background technology
Sludge drying is, by the effect such as diafiltration or evaporation, the process of most of water content to be removed from sludge, is referred generally to Using spontaneous evaporation facilities such as sludge drying beds (bed).The tail gas main component of foul smelling taste can be produced during sludge drying There is NOX、NH3、H2S and CH4Deng will necessarily be produced if the tail gas after sludge drying can not be handled in time to sludge drying device Corrosiveness, influences its service life.

Embodiment
Below in conjunction with the accompanying drawings and the utility model is described in detail embodiment.
The utility model provides a kind of mud drying device, as shown in figure 1, being absorbed including feed arrangement 1 and activated carbon Tower 3, the bottom of feed arrangement 1 is provided with the first conveying worm 9, and the discharging opening of the first conveying worm 9 is connected with drying machine 4, The top of drying machine 4 is provided with air inlet 1-1, and air inlet 1-1 is connected with heat blower 2 by pipeline, and the bottom of drying machine 4 is provided with the One discharging opening 1-2, the first discharging opening 1-2 are connected with the second conveying worm 10, and drying machine 4 is additionally provided with the second discharging opening 1-3, and Two discharging opening 1-3 are connected with cyclone dust collectors 6, the discharging opening and the second conveying worm of the bottom of cyclone dust collectors 6 by pipeline 10 connections, the exhaust outlet at the top of cyclone dust collectors 6 is connected with the first blower fan 5 by pipeline 11, and the exhaust outlet of the first blower fan 5 passes through Pipeline is connected with the air inlet of heat blower 2;The air inlet of charcoal trap 3 is connected with the second blower fan 8 by pipeline, the The air inlet of two blower fans 8 is connected by pipeline with pipeline 11.
Sack cleaner 7 is provided between second blower fan 8 and cyclone dust collectors 6, the dust and gas entrance of sack cleaner 7 passes through pipe Road is connected with the exhaust outlet of the second blower fan 8, and the net gas outlet of sack cleaner 7 passes through the air inlet of pipeline and charcoal trap 3 Mouth is connected;The dust outlet of the bottom of sack cleaner 7 is connected with the second conveying worm 10.
Agitator is provided with feed arrangement 1.
In use, as shown in figure 1, after sludge is encased in feed arrangement 1, the agitator set in feed arrangement 1 Carry out preliminary stirring broken, be then transported to by the first conveying worm 9 in drying machine 4, it is dirty during conveying Mud can be crushed again, and sludge is entered to be dried in the cylinder of drying machine 4, and drying machine 4 is rotary shelf drier, drying machine 4 are connected with heat blower 2, and heated dry air is manufactured by combustion gas, purge the sludge for the rolling that is broken, until sludge reaches accordingly Moisture content.Dried sludge is discharged into the second conveying worm 10 by the first discharging opening 1-2, is then then exhausted from, The smaller particle carried in system is separated in the second conveying worm 10 by cyclone separator 6, is thereafter let out, drying sludge mistake The foul smell produced in journey is transported in charcoal trap 3 by the second blower fan 8 and filtered, in charcoal trap 3 The sack cleaner 7 being provided between the second blower fan 8 can catch the air in dust small in system, cleaning system.
